Seeking a Bridge Inspector (CBI) licensed by the Florida Department of Transportation. Candidate shall be familiar with the FDOT Bridge Inventory Database System. Looking for a technical individual, team oriented with strong communication skills. Individual must be willing to travel and work outside.
General Duties & Responsibilities: individual is expected to be familiar with following:
- Lead bridge inspection team in the field to comply with Florida and National Bridge Inspection requirements.
- Supervise one or more assistant inspectors in the field.
- Organize and enter inspector's notes into the Bridge Management System (BMS).
- Organize and enter inspector's recommendations into the Bridge Management System (BMS).
- Prepare reports for submission.
- Individual will be required to take and convert measurements.

Qualifications
What you bring to our firm:
- High School Diploma or GED
- Active CBI certification.
- NHI certification in the Safety Inspection of Fracture Critical Bridges.
- NHI certification in the Inspection and Maintenance of Ancillary Highway Structures.
- Minimum basic knowledge of computers and typing.
- Working kn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, OneNote, Excel, Outlook, Teams).
